Chimney replacement services involve removing an existing chimney structure and installing a new one to ensure safe and efficient venting for fireplaces, wood stoves, or heating systems. This process typically includes assessing the condition of the current chimney, preparing the site, and carefully installing a durable new chimney that meets the specific needs of the property. Skilled contractors focus on proper installation techniques to prevent issues such as leaks, structural damage, or poor draft performance, helping homeowners maintain a functional and safe fireplace or heating system.
Many properties encounter problems that make chimney replacement necessary. Common issues include significant cracks, deterioration of mortar or bricks, rusted or damaged liners, and structural instability caused by age or weather exposure. These problems can lead to dangerous situations like smoke or carbon monoxide leaks, or even chimney collapse. Replacing an aging or compromised chimney can restore safety, improve heating efficiency, and prevent costly repairs down the line. The overview below groups typical Chimney Replacement proj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Worcester, MA.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or chimney repairs, such as patching cracks or rebuilding a section, generally range from $250 to $600. Many routine jobs fall within this middle range, depending on the extent of damage.
Partial Replacement - Replacing a section of the chimney or repairing the flue liner usually costs between $1,000 and $3,500. Larger, more complex projects can reach higher amounts but are less common.
Full Chimney Replacement - Complete replacement of a chimney often costs from $4,000 to $8,000, with some extensive or custom jobs exceeding this range. Many full rebuilds fall into the middle to upper part of this spectrum.
Larger or Complex Projects - Extensive renovations, such as rebuilding a historic chimney or handling structural issues, can exceed $10,000. These projects are less frequent and typically involve specialized service providers.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

When should a chimney be replaced instead of repaired? A chimney may need replacement if it shows extensive damage, such as large cracks, crumbling masonry, or compromised structural integrity that cannot be effectively repaired.
What are common signs indicating a chimney needs replacement? Signs include persistent leaks, significant spalling or deterioration of bricks, damaged or missing mortar, and visible leaning or bulging sections of the chimney.
How do local contractors handle chimney replacement projects? They typically assess the chimney's condition, recommend appropriate replacement methods, and perform the work using suitable materials to ensure safety and durability.
Can a chimney replacement improve the safety of a home? Yes, replacing an aging or damaged chimney can eliminate hazards such as falling debris, leaks, or structural failure that could pose safety risks.
What types of materials are used in chimney replacement? Common materials include durable bricks, concrete, and mortar designed to withstand weathering and provide long-lasting support for the chimney structure.
